package itest
import (
"github.com/btcsuite/btcd/btcutil"
"github.com/lightningnetwork/lnd/lnrpc"
"github.com/lightningnetwork/lnd/lntest"
"github.com/stretchr/testify/require"
"google.golang.org/grpc/codes"
"google.golang.org/grpc/status"
)
// testLookupHtlcResolution checks that `LookupHtlcResolution` returns the
// correct HTLC information.
func testLookupHtlcResolution(ht *lntest.HarnessTest) {
const chanAmt = btcutil.Amount(1000000)
alice := ht.NewNodeWithCoins("Alice", nil)
carol := ht.NewNode("Carol", []string{
"--store-final-htlc-resolutions",
})
ht.EnsureConnected(alice, carol)
// Open a channel between Alice and Carol.
cp := ht.OpenChannel(
alice, carol, lntest.OpenChannelParams{Amt: chanAmt},
)
// Channel should be ready for payments.
const payAmt = 100
// Create an invoice.
invoice := &lnrpc.Invoice{
Memo: "alice to carol htlc lookup",
RPreimage: ht.Random32Bytes(),
Value: payAmt,
}
// Carol adds the invoice to her database.
resp := carol.RPC.AddInvoice(invoice)
// Subscribe the invoice.
stream := carol.RPC.SubscribeSingleInvoice(resp.RHash)
// Alice pays Carol's invoice.
ht.CompletePaymentRequests(alice, []string{resp.PaymentRequest})
// Carol waits until the invoice is settled.
ht.AssertInvoiceState(stream, lnrpc.Invoice_SETTLED)
// Get the channel using the assert function.
//
// TODO(yy): make `ht.OpenChannel` return lnrpc.Channel instead of
// lnrpc.ChannelPoint.
channel := ht.AssertChannelExists(carol, cp)
// Lookup the HTLC and assert the htlc is settled offchain.
req := &lnrpc.LookupHtlcResolutionRequest{
ChanId: channel.ChanId,
HtlcIndex: 0,
}
// Check that Alice will get an error from LookupHtlcResolution.
err := alice.RPC.LookupHtlcResolutionAssertErr(req)
gErr := status.Convert(err)
require.Equal(ht, codes.Unavailable, gErr.Code())
// Check that Carol can get the final htlc info.
finalHTLC := carol.RPC.LookupHtlcResolution(req)
require.True(ht, finalHTLC.Settled, "htlc should be settled")
require.True(ht, finalHTLC.Offchain, "htlc should be Offchain")
}
